Pre-Delivery and Installation 
Checklist
Most  cities  and  counties  require  permits  for  exterior  construction  and 
electrical  circuits.  In  addition,  some  communities  have  codes  requiring 
residential barriers such as fencing and/or self-closing gates on property to 
prevent unsupervised access to the property by children under the age of 
5. Your dealer can provide information on which permits may be required 
and how to obtain them prior to the delivery of your Cal Spa
®
.
We strongly recommend you have a qualified, licensed contractor perform 
the installation of your in-ground or ported spa. The installation instructions 
contained  in  the  manual  are  for  the  use  of  a  qualified  contractor  or 
installer.
Consumers  who  choose  to  install  their  own  in-ground  spas  bear  sole 
responsibility for any performance or warranty issues and may void portions 
of their warranty as a result. For this reason, we strongly recommend they 
hire an experienced professional for their installation.

Portable Spa 
Pre-Delivery Checklist
Before Delivery
Plan your delivery route
Choose a suitable location 
for the spa
Lay a 3” -  4” concrete slab
Install dedicated electrical 
supply
After Delivery
Place spa on slab
Connect electrical 
components
 
In-Ground Spa 
Pre-Delivery Checklist
Before Delivery
Plan your delivery route
Choose a suitable location 
for the shell and equipment 
pack
Excavate the hole
Install dedicated electrical 
supply
Install dedicated NG line for 
gas heater
After Delivery
Install shell in ground
Install equipment pack
Connect plumbing
Connect electrical 
components
Pour the deck
